Job Detail
  • Utilizes observational skills, testing procedures, and setup techniques to diagnose plumbing issues effectively.

  • Manages a wide range of plumbing repairs including stoppages, pump maintenance, fixture installations, leak repairs, and advanced troubleshooting techniques.
  • Responsible for water heater maintenance/troubleshooting/replacement and boiler maintenance, boiler pumps and circulating, boiler controller, troubleshooting and system installation.

  • Required plumbing repair skills: Stoppages/cabling, pumping and backflow testing/repair/replacement
  • Fixture install/replacement
  • General troubleshooting and repair
  • Domestic water/sewer or storm water leak/repair, fixture rough-in
  • Pump replacement/repair
  • Leak locating/line tracing
  • Hydro jetting and camera. Required water heater skills: Planned maintenance, troubleshooting and replacement. Required boiler skills: Planned maintenance, boiler pumps and circulating, boiler controller (external), troubleshooting and system installation.
